Five public issues are set to hit Dalal Street next week in the mainboard segment. "Tata Technologies' IPO pricing, set at Rs 475 to Rs 500 per share, significantly exceeds Rs 401.8, its pre-IPO placement price, indicating strong confidence in its market potential and future growth," Sonam Srivastava, founder and fund manager at Wright Research, says in an interview to Moneycontrol.

On the Indian Renewable Energy Development Agency (IREDA), she believes, the renewable energy sector's growth potential is significant, but it's also subject to policy changes and technological advancements, which could influence IREDA's performance.

On the new RBI norms with respect to increase in risk weight on consumer credit exposure, Srivastava, with more than 10 years of experience in quantitative research and portfolio management, says this change will likely lead to a tightening of capital available for lending, which is a critical aspect of NBFC operations, but overall, the impact of this decision will vary across NBFCs, depending on their individual risk profiles and business models.
